Abstract

The invention discloses a nighttime image enhancement method based on multi-path decomposition, which is applied in the technical field of image processing. Aiming at the problem that the prior art cannot remove noise well during nighttime image processing, the invention first bases on the global noise of the nighttime image to be processed To estimate the level, decompose the nighttime image to be processed into the base layer image and the detail layer image; then perform brightness adaptation calculation on the base layer image; secondly correct the color of the base layer brightness adaptation image; perform edge protection and detail layer image again Noise suppression; finally, the color-corrected base layer image is fused with the edge-protected and noise-suppressed detail layer image to obtain an enhanced nighttime image; the method of the present invention can well remove the noise interference of the nighttime image.

Description

technical field [0001] The invention belongs to the field of image processing, in particular to a technology for enhancing nighttime images. Background technique [0002] In image processing, images acquired in night scenes often have problems such as low brightness, uneven illumination, and large noise interference. Low-quality night images often affect the performance of computing systems based on image information, such as night surveillance systems. Therefore, it is of great significance to perform visual enhancement preprocessing (such as denoising, brightness enhancement, detail enhancement, etc.) on the low-quality nighttime images collected by the device. A typical image enhancement method at night or in low brightness is the image enhancement method based on light source estimation (LIME), see the literature "X.Guo, Y.Li, and H.Ling, "LIME:Low-light imageenhancement via illumination map estimation, "IEEE Trans. Image Processing, vol. 26, no. 2, pp. 982–993, 2017."...
